titleOfInvention | Preparation of poly(benz(ox, imid, thi)azole) polymers |
abstract | PREPARATION OF POLY(BENZ(OX, IMID, THI)AZOLE) POLYMERS ABSTRACT A method for the preparation of poly(benzoxazole)s, poly(benzimidazole)s, and poly(benzthiazole)s. In the presence of solvent and catalyst, reacting carbon monoxide, an aromatic halide reactant having the general formula X1-Ar1-Z1 and an aromatic amine reactant having the general formula Z2-Ar2-M1, wherein X1 and Z1 are non-ortho, Z2 and M1 are non-ortho, one of Z1 and Z2 is X2 and the other one is M2, -Ar1-and -Ar2- are each independently selected from the group consisting of aromatic and hetero-aromatic moieties having a total of ring carbons and heteroatoms of from 6 to about 20, X1 and X2 are each independently selected from the group consisting of -I and -Br, and M1 and M2 are each independently selected from moieties having an -NH2 radical and, ortho to the -NH2 radical, a radical selected from the group consisting of -NH2, -OH, and -SH. Polymers of the classes: poly(benzoxazole), poly(benzimidazole), and poly(benzthiazole) are used in composites and laminates and as high strength fibers and films possessing good thermal and oxidative stability. |
